Sodium in PDB 4uwo: Native Di-Zinc Vim-26. LEU224 in Vim-26 From Klebsiella Pneumoniae Has Implications For Drug Binding.Protein crystallography data
The structure of Native Di-Zinc Vim-26. LEU224 in Vim-26 From Klebsiella Pneumoniae Has Implications For Drug Binding., PDB code: 4uwo
was solved by
H.-K.S.Leiros,
K.S.W.Edvardsen,
G.E.K.Bjerga,
O.Samuelsen,
with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:
